The Tampa Bay Buccaneers haven’t exactly had great success drafting at the quarterback position. The list is long and arduous to say the least. The team has two championships, both by quarterbacks signed via free agency.

The Buccaneers selected quarterback Kyle Trask at 64th overall in this years draft. With quarterback Tom Brady at the helm, the Buccaneers won’t need someone to start immediately. So how is Trask preparing for his role with the Buccaneers? Watch the video below as he explains.

Trask talks about being in the room and learning from the greatest is an “experience like no other”. The 23 year old quarterback from Manvel Texas is no stranger to working his way up the depth chart. From high school through college, Trask has always had to climb the ladder. Trask went on to talk about the similarities of the offense he ran at Florida compared to the Bucs offense. He pointed out the run game and throwing from the pocket as two big similarities.

Trask appears to have fallen into the perfect situation here in Tampa. The Buccaneers have finally put themselves in the position to develop a quarterback the right way.
